We all know William Windom from Murder She Wrote, and Star Trek: The Doomsday Machine, and Columbo, and a million other roles, but he did pop up in 6.15 All Thieves On Deck, and he did publish his memoirs in 2009: 'Journeyman Actor: A Memoir'.

Carl Ciarfalio, highly regarded Hollywood stuntman, who appeared in 6.13 Summer School, published his memoirs in 2015: 'Stars, Stunts and Stories: A Hollywood Stuntman's Fall to Fame'.

Henry Darrow of The High Chaparral fame co-wrote his memoirs in 'Henry Darrow: Lightning in the Bottle' (2015). He was a guest star in 6.8 Paniolo.

Brit actor Arthur English had a small part in 6.2 Deja Vu Part 2 as a newspaper seller, but he's more well known for his role in BBC sitcom Are You Being Served? In 1986 he published his memoirs, 'Through the Mill and Beyond'.

Dennis Weaver (5.18 Let Me Hear The Music), best known for McCloud, Gunsmoke, and Duel, wrote his autobiography in 2001, 'All the World's a Stage'.
